Physician Assistant School – What Does it Take to Get In?
To apply to the Duke PA Program you must use the CASPA or Centralized Application Service Physician Assistant. After you have finished that application and submitted it, Duke will send you an e-mail that gives you authorization to access the Duke supplemental application. In addition you must have 1000 hours of direct patient care experience. Duke is very specific about what this means so read their website to be sure you have met that qualification. You will need three recommendations, one of which must come from someone who has seen you provide patient care. For the 2009 year you must complete CASPA and the Duke supplemental applications after May 1 and before Oct 1, 2008. The Supplemental form by 15 Nov 2008. The class that entered Duke in 2007 were chosen from 570 applications and had the following group qualifications.
